The move, in three file-based steps

Works today, documented, free, and yours to run. No vendor call required to leave a vendor.

Your lists, by CSV

Xero exports contacts and items as spreadsheets, and ERPClaw imports CSV with explicit duplicate handling, so your master records come across without retyping.

Your bank history, from the bank

Statement files in OFX, CAMT.053, MT940, or BAI2 come straight from your bank and match themselves to open invoices and payments. No connector fee, no third party.

Opening balances, then go

Set your opening balances and the books start clean, with history where you need it and a clear line where ERPClaw takes over.

Does ERPClaw cover my region like Xero does?

UK and EU regional coverage is built in, alongside US, Canada, and India. If you run in Australia or New Zealand, Xero's local depth there is real; compare carefully for those two.

What about multi-currency?

Payments settle in the currency each invoice was raised in, across the currencies ERPClaw supports. ERPClaw deliberately never converts currency inside a transaction, which keeps a self-run ledger defensible.
